#5bde79 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5bde79 is composed of 35.7% red, 87.1%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.5%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 133.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 61.4%. #5bde79 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6fff2 with #00bd00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#5bde79 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5bde79 has RGB values of R:91, G:222,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 6020729.

Hex triplet 5bde79 #5bde79
RGB Decimal 91, 222, 121 rgb(91,222,121)
RGB Percent 35.7, 87.1, 47.5 rgb(35.7%,87.1%,47.5%)
CMYK 59, 0, 45, 13
HSL 133.7°, 66.5, 61.4 hsl(133.7,66.5%,61.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 133.7°, 59, 87.1
Web Safe 66cc66 #66cc66
CIE-LAB 79.525, -57.211, 38.922
XYZ 33.885, 55.844, 27.081
xyY 0.29, 0.478, 55.844
CIE-LCH 79.525, 69.196, 145.772
CIE-LUV 79.525, -57.466, 61.165
Hunter-Lab 74.729, -49.838, 30.824
Binary 01011011, 11011110, 01111001

Shades and Tints of #5bde79

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031006 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5bde79

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98a19a is the less saturated color, while #3dfc69 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#5bde79 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#ababab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9bb5a1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#dac877 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#edbf8b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#83d4e3 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#acd078 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b8ca84 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#74d7bc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
